Abstract

The utility model discloses a road vehicle speed and distance measuring device based on video, including video speed measurement control device, video information acquisition device, power supply unit, storage device, wireless communication device and backstage management device, storage device wireless communication device all with video speed measurement control device electric connection, power supply unit provides required mains voltage for the video speed measurement control device, video information acquisition device with the video speed measurement control device is electric connection in proper order, the video speed measurement control device through the wireless communication device with backstage management device communicates; the utility model has the advantages that: through video information collection system, can realize vehicle information acquisition on the highway, convenient and fast through the back platform management device, can realize looking over and control vehicle speed on the highway in real time.

Some video-based road speed and distance measuring devices as shown in fig. 1 include: the video speed measurement control device comprises a video speed measurement control device, a video information acquisition device, a voice alarm device, a power supply device, a storage device, a wireless communication device and a background management device, wherein the video information acquisition device is sequentially and electrically connected with the video speed measurement control device, the storage device, the voice alarm device and the wireless communication device are electrically connected with the video speed measurement control device, the power supply device provides required power supply voltage for the video speed measurement control device, and the background management device is communicated with the video speed measurement control device through the wireless communication device.
The video information acquisition device comprises a video acquisition device and a video processing device, and the video acquisition device and the video processing device are arranged on a single rod beside a road.
The video acquisition device comprises a video acquisition module, a license plate recognition module and a light supplementing module.
The video acquisition module is used for acquiring image information of vehicles on a road, and the license plate recognition module is used for recognizing license plate information in the image information of the vehicles on the road. The output end of the video acquisition module is connected with the input end of the license plate recognition module.
Specifically, the video capture module may be, but is not limited to, a CDD camera, a high-definition camcorder, and the like. The utility model discloses a CDD camera gathers vehicle information and license plate information.
The light supplementing module is used for supplementing light when the light is dark, and the light supplementing module is a license plate light supplementing lamp.
The video processing device is an analog-to-digital conversion device which converts analog signals output by the video information acquisition device into digital signals.
The video speed measurement control device is the core of the road speed measurement and distance measurement device and is used for extracting video information in the video information acquisition device, determining the number of vehicle image frames with the same license plate information, and calculating the running time of a vehicle corresponding to the same license plate information in an acquisition interval of the video acquisition device according to the number of the vehicle image frames and the set time so as to determine the running speed of the vehicle. The video speed measurement control device can adopt a singlechip, a DSP processor and the like.
Preferably, the utility model provides a video speed measurement controlling means adopts the singlechip, installs on the single pole of highway next door.
The wireless communication device is used for transmitting speed and distance measuring information on a road, and the background management device is connected with the video speed measuring control device through the wireless communication device.
The wireless communication apparatus includes: a WiFi device and an ethernet communication device.
Specifically, the video speed measurement control device transmits data to the background management device in a WiFi mode or an Ethernet mode, so that real-time data interaction is realized.
The background management device is used for receiving and displaying information of the highway speed and distance measuring device, and can be a computer, an industrial personal computer, a cloud server and the like.
Preferably, the utility model provides a backstage management device chooses for use the computer, can look over at any time, monitor the information of measuring speed range unit on the highway.
The voice alarm device is used for giving an alarm when the speed of the vehicle on the road is higher or lower than the preset value of the video speed measurement control device. The voice alarm device comprises a voice alarm chip and a loudspeaker, wherein the voice alarm chip is electrically connected with the loudspeaker and is arranged on a single rod beside the highway.
Specifically, the voice alarm chip adopts a WT5886-16S voice chip. The voice alarm chip sends out the sound through the loudspeaker to remind the driver of paying attention to the control of the vehicle speed.
The utility model discloses work as follows:
when the light is good, when a vehicle passes through a single rod beside a road, a video acquisition module of a video acquisition device standing on the single rod beside the road carries out continuous image acquisition on a video signal, the acquired image information is subjected to license plate information identification through a license plate identification module, an analog-to-digital conversion module in the video processing device processes the information to obtain a digital signal, the digital signal is transmitted to a video speed measurement control device, the video speed measurement control device carries out image frame number and set time with the same license plate information to further obtain the driving distance and speed information of the vehicle, the distance and speed information is stored in a storage device, and meanwhile, the driving distance and speed information of the vehicle are transmitted to a background management device through a wireless communication device.
When light on a road is dark, a vehicle passes through a single rod beside the road, the light supplementing module on the single rod supplements light, it is ensured that a video acquisition module can acquire clear images, the image information is subjected to license plate information identification through a license plate identification module, the image information is processed by a video processing device and then is sent to a video speed measurement control device through information, the video speed measurement control device obtains the distance and the speed information of the vehicle in running by setting the number of image frames with the same license plate information and the time, and stores the speed information in a storage device, and meanwhile, the distance information and the speed information of the vehicle in running are transmitted to a background management device through a wireless communication device.
And if the vehicle speed information is normal, the vehicle speed information is sent to the background management device through the communication device. If the vehicle speed information is lower than or higher than the preset value of the video speed measurement control device, the voice alarm device carries out voice alarm and informs a driver of paying attention to the control of the vehicle speed.
